//Implementing Friend-Pairing problem using dynamic programming
//hacktoberfest2021
// https://practice.geeksforgeeks.org/problems/friends-pairing-problem5425/1#
#include <bits/stdc++.h>
using namespace std;
// } Driver Code Ends
class Solution
{
public:
//Function to return the total number of ways in which 'n' friends can remain single or can be paired up.
int countFriendsPairings(int n)
{
// Your code here
long long int mod=1000000000+7;
long long int dp[n+1];
for(int i=0;i<=n;i++)
{
if(i<=2)
{
dp[i]=i%mod;
}
else
{
dp[i]=(dp[i-1]%mod+(i-1)*(dp[i-2]%mod))%mod;
}
}
return dp[n]%(mod);
}
};
// { Driver Code Starts.
int main()
{
//taking total testcases
int t;
cin>>t;
while(t--)
{
// reading total friends
int n;
cin>>n;
Solution ob;
//calling method countFriendsPairings
cout <<ob.countFriendsPairings(n);
cout<<endl;
}
}
// } Driver Code Ends
